Synopsis of El cuervo de la Barbacana
El cuervo de la Barbacana es una novela de misterio histórico escrita por Ellis Peters, ambientada en la Inglaterra del siglo XII. Fray Cadfael, el monje detective, se enfrenta a un nuevo caso cuando el abad Radulfo regresa de Londres con un sacerdote para la Santa Cruz, un hombre de gran erudición pero carente de humildad. Tras ser hallado ahogado, las sospechas recaen sobre un joven que acompañaba al sacerdote y una joven de gran belleza. Cadfael deberá desentrañar la verdad tras este misterioso suceso.

Edith Pargeter
Edith Mary Pargeter, also known by her pen name Ellis Peters, was an English author of works in many categories, especially history and historical fiction, and was also honoured for her translations of Czech classics. She is probably best known for her murder mysteries, both historical and modern, and especially for her medieval detective series The Cadfael Chronicles.
